Easy Garlic Knots

These easy Garlic Knots are an irresistible crowd pleaser. Made with pizza dough, they are baked until golden brown and then brushed with a delicious garlic butter parmesan sauce.

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 375°F (or temperature on pizza dough package) and lightly grease a baking sheet with butter or olive oil.
  • Roll out pizza dough and cut into 12 pieces. Roll pieces into tube shapes, then tie into knots. Put garlic knots on the prepared baking sheet and bake for 10-12 minutes or until golden brown.
  • While baking, melt the but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Add garlic and saute for 1 minute. Remove from the heat and stir in salt and parsley. Baste each cooked garlic knot generously with the garlic butter sauce. Sprinkle with Parmesan cheese.
  • Serve with pizza sauce or marinara sauce for dipping.

Notes

Store leftovers in the fridge for up to 3 days or in the freezer for up to 6 months.
